1960’s Silver Metallic Lace Mini Dress

About the Item

Incredible 1960’s silver metallic lace mini dress with white sleeveless lining, metallic threading, sheer sleeves, pearly buttons and dramatic wide lapels. No labels aside from "Dry Clean Only" & white tab with materials, reads "Lot 3" & "Size 9." Size: Small Measurements: Bust: 34” Waist: 30-31" Hips: Free Sleeve Length: 21” Sleeve Opening: 8” Front Length: 26” Back Length: 31”

    Stephen Burrows is an American fashion designer based in New York City, known for being one of the first African-American fashion designers to sell internationally and develop a mainstream, high-fashion clientele. His garments, known for their bright colors and "lettuce hem" curly-edges, became an integral part of the disco-dancing scene of the 1970s. Burrows was one of the five American designers to show at the iconic Versailles battle in 1973 when the Americans went up against the French couturiers.
